FP1: Nico quickest as Max debuts
Nico Rosberg's hopes of returning to the top of the Championship standings where given a boost on Friday morning when he was quickest at Suzuka. The Mercedes driver hit the front of the timesheets on his very first run of the morning and never looked back. Upping his pace with each run, Rosberg finished FP1 with a 1:35.461, putting him 0.151s ahead of his team-mate Lewis Hamilton. It was a good result for the German as, last time out in Singapore, the seven-time grand prix winner lost the lead in the Championship when his car broke down. Heading into Sunday's Japanese GP, Rosberg trails Hamilton by three points. While the Mercedes drivers tussled at the front, all eyes were on Max...
